Fix TAB-completion + .gdb_index slowness (generalize filename_seen_cache)
Tab completion when debugging a program binary that uses GDB index is surprisingly much slower than when GDB uses psymtabs instead. Around 1.5x/3x slower. That's surprising, because the whole point of GDB index is to speed things up... For example, with: set pagination off set $count = 0 while $count < 400 complete b string_prin # matches gdb's string_printf printf "count = %d\n", $count set $count = $count + 1 end $ time ./gdb --batch -q ./gdb-with-index -ex "source script.cmd" real 0m11.042s user 0m10.920s sys 0m0.042s $ time ./gdb --batch -q ./gdb-without-index -ex "source script.cmd" real 0m4.635s user 0m4.590s sys 0m0.037s Same but with: - complete b string_prin + complete b zzzzzz to exercise the no-matches worst case, master currently gets you something like: with index without index real 0m11.971s 0m8.413s user 0m11.912s 0m8.355s sys 0m0.035s 0m0.035s Running gdb under perf shows 80% spent inside maybe_add_partial_symtab_filename, and 20% spent in the lbasename inside that. The problem that tab completion walks over all compunit symtabs, and for each, walks the contained file symtabs. And there a huge number of file symtabs (each included system header, etc.) that appear in each compunit symtab's file symtab list. As in, when debugging GDB, I have 367381 symtabs iterated, when of those only 5371 filenames are unique... This was a regression from the earlier (nice) split of symtabs in compunit symtabs + file symtabs. The fix here is to add a cache of unique filenames per objfile so that the walk / uniquing is only done once. There's already a abstraction for this in symtab.c; this patch moves that code out to a separate file and C++ifies it bit. This makes the worst-case scenario above consistently drop to ~2.5s (1.5s for the "string_prin" hit case), making it over 3.3x times faster than psymtabs in this use case (7x in the "string_prin" hit case). gdb/ChangeLog: 2017-07-17 Pedro Alves <palves@redhat.com> * Makefile.in (COMMON_OBS): Add filename-seen-cache.o. * dwarf2read.c: Include "filename-seen-cache.h". * dwarf2read.c (dwarf2_per_objfile) <filenames_cache>: New field. + /* Initial size of the table. It automagically grows from here. */
+#define INITIAL_FILENAME_SEEN_CACHE_SIZE 100
+
+/* filename_seen_cache constructor. */
+
+filename_seen_cache::filename_seen_cache ()
+{
+ m_tab = htab_create_alloc (INITIAL_FILENAME_SEEN_CACHE_SIZE,
+ filename_hash, filename_eq,
+ NULL, xcalloc, xfree);
+}
+
+/* See filename-seen-cache.h. */
+
+void
+filename_seen_cache::clear ()
+{
+ htab_empty (m_tab);
+}
+
+/* See filename-seen-cache.h. */
+
+filename_seen_cache::~filename_seen_cache ()
+{
+ htab_delete (m_tab);
+}
+
+/* See filename-seen-cache.h. */
+
+bool
+filename_seen_cache::seen (const char *file)
+{
+ void **slot;
+
+ /* Is FILE in tab? */
+ slot = htab_find_slot (m_tab, file, INSERT);
+ if (*slot != NULL)
+ return true;
+
+ /* No; add it to tab. */
+ *slot = (char *) file;
+ return false;
+}
